A Habitat for Wildlife
In addition to its gardens, Mayfield Park is also home to a variety of wildlife, including ducks and peacocks. The park’s peaceful atmosphere makes it an ideal habitat for these animals, and visitors often enjoy watching them roam freely throughout the park. The peacocks, in particular, are a popular attraction, with their stunning plumage and graceful movements. Watching them strut around the grounds is a highlight for many visitors to Austin.

Accessibility and Visitor Information
Mayfield Park is open to the public year-round, and there is no admission fee to visit. The park is easily accessible by car, with ample parking available for visitors. It’s also located near other popular attractions in Austin, making it a convenient destination for those exploring the city.
The park is open every day, and the hours vary depending on the season. It’s a good idea to check the park’s website or call ahead for information about specific events, hours, and any potential closures. The park is also pet-friendly, so you can bring your furry friends along to enjoy the outdoors with you in Austin.
